Output 59583879690803de52af253e378c228b138de15bf1c019ce28e7703c95abe3e1:0

value
524424
script pubkey
OP_0 OP_PUSHBYTES_20 00bbb690412ef863a451c9eeec007ea018051616
address
bc1qqzamdyzp9mux8fz3e8hwcqr75qvq29skmrvs9q
transaction
59583879690803de52af253e378c228b138de15bf1c019ce28e7703c95abe3e1